通常连接MODBUS仪表和S7-300系统都使用DP转MODBUS设备,一般带DP口的S7300PLC都比较昂贵而且还要买DP转MODBUS的转换器价格也不菲,一般价格都在2000以上。并且受西门子PROFIBUS-DP协议的影响,改转换器仅能传送或接收244个字节。这对连接MODBUS仪表是个非常不利的因素。并且组态时是通过GSD文件,很不灵活。对于有些特殊功能的通讯或与MODBUS协议略有偏差的仪表设备就不能很好的进行通讯,缺乏灵活性。如果使用西门子S7-200 smart PLC,它的价格很低廉,在¥700左右,它有一个485自由编程口,用户可根据需求对自由口进行自由编程。可以非常灵活的与各种MODBUS仪表和特种协议仪表连接,几乎涵盖了国内所有不用类型的通讯规约,都可以用它来通讯。通讯的结果再通过大连德嘉的多功能交换机B型产品将数据与西门子300PN和MPI+大连德嘉的ETH-MPI或CP343将数据与300系统通过以太网交换。就可以非常灵活的解决这一难题。
本人认为用西门子S7-300带PN的CPU+大连德嘉的多功能转换器B型产品再加上多个西门子S7-200 smart PLC 就可以解决众多的仪表与PLC的通讯问题。而且价格最低廉,效果非常好。不用学习很多额外的知识,比如说如果使用DP-MODBUS转换器的话,你将有一大堆的资料等着你来看,费力费时,效果还不是很好。
经常有客户问我们,有没有一种万能的转换器将它与各种规约都连接在一起。
当时我们说用S7-200自由口通讯就可以了。但是由于S7-200价格还是有点太贵,现在有了S7-200smart PLC价格非常低,所以我推荐大家使用这款多功能交换机来解决复杂通讯问题